It's a bit out there, but Michael Poulsen best explained the song, stating that, "Sometimes we don’t understand why people die around us – it doesn’t make sense. I’m singing about a spiritual world, where there is some kind of reaper who punishes people for not treating themselves and the people around them well by taking a random soul. We’re left here, not knowing why that person has died. The reaper is saying, ‘I’ll take a random soul, and you are the sinner without knowing."
The title "The sinner is you" adds to the idea that each person is responsible for their own actions and the impact they have on the world surrounding them.
